SOME FILLER CHARACTERISTICS OBSERVED ON THE HOCKING COUNTY FILLER TEST ROAD

ADDED TO THE RESULTS OF THE PLANNED OBSERVATIONS ON THE HOCKING COUNTY FILLER TEST ROAD IS INFORMATION ON THE EFFECT OF MECHANICAL WORKING ON THE EXUDING OF ASPHALT FILLERS FOR BRICK JOINTS. IN ADDITION TO OTHER BENEFITS A NON-EXUDING FILLER PRODUCES A SURFACE COURSE NOTICEABLE MORE QUIET THAN A SURFACE COURSE WITH EXUDED FILLER. /AUTHOR/
